What To Weigh Before Choosing a 65 Inch Couch
Measure Twice, Buy Once
The most common buying regret in this category isn’t comfort. It’s a couch that arrives and won’t make it through the doorway or up the stairwell. Measure doorways, hallways, and elevator openings before you commit, and account for any turns between the entry and the living room. Modularity helps here: a 119 inch Vesgantti sectional can be broken into smaller pieces, while a fixed loveseat is one rigid block you have to angle through tight corners.
Decide on the Sleeper Question First
A 65 inch range covers two very different use cases. Fixed loveseats like the Tbfit sit firmly and look like traditional seating, while futon-style options from Shahoo and Pipishell convert into a bed at the cost of a thinner seat. Households that host overnight guests even a few times a year usually find the convertible design pays for itself, while households that never host benefit from the firmer, deeper cushion of a fixed frame.
Material Drives Maintenance More Than Comfort
Leather-look finishes wipe clean and shrug off spills, but they can feel sticky in warm rooms. Corduroy brings warmth and a softer hand, but it traps pet hair, crumbs, and dust in the nap, so weekly vacuuming becomes part of the ownership routine. Woven fabric upholstery on a mid century frame wears well but shows stains faster, which matters in homes with kids or pets.
Watch the Seat Depth
Depth, the distance from the front edge of the cushion to the backrest, decides how the couch actually gets used. Shallow seats around 20 inches suit upright sitting and conversation, while deeper 24 inch-plus seats invite lounging and curling up. Sectionals with deep seats and ottomans turn into a small bed on their own, while shallower loveseats stay more structured.
Key Considerations Across These Picks
Pitfalls Shoppers Hit
The single biggest mistake is choosing by total width and ignoring seat depth, so a “65 inch” couch ends up feeling either too small to lounge on or too deep to sit upright on. Measure the room including walkways, then check the seat depth on the spec sheet. A second slip is ignoring doorways and stairwells until delivery day, which turns a great-looking pick into a return headache. Finally, skip the assumption that all convertibles sleep the same way, because futon sleepers are firmer than a real mattress and that difference matters for frequent guests.
Where The Extra Money Goes
Higher-priced entries in this category tend to spend the budget on frame construction, where FSC certified wood and spring-supported cushions hold their shape longer than a basic foam-and-particleboard build. You also pay for modularity, meaning the ability to reconfigure as a U, L, or flat layout, plus upholstery upgrades like corduroy or higher-grade leather-look. For shoppers who plan to keep the same couch for many years, those upgrades usually show up as fewer sags and a cleaner look over time.
